The International Center for Academic Integrity (ICAI) defines academic integrity as a commitment to six fundamental values: honesty, trust, fairness, respect, responsibility and courage. By embracing these fundamental values, instructors, students, staff, and administrators create effective academic communities where integrity is at the foundation. The Selkirk College Options for Sexual Health Clinic is an on-campus drop-in clinic for students and local community members. The clinic is run by registered nurses and Nursing Program students. Free & Confidential Appointments The free clinic is non-biased and non-judgemental. It's open to all ages, genders and orientations from September to April. It is completely confidential.
